Output 2fb785ab3e7755d512005dd6ec9aaaf3bcc3e9160beb8fe741d304973e252cf9:27

value
570956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 315323ac232eef03911eb942b4663cfcfb68bdf7 OP_EQUAL
address
36BpdZoj8AhNN3UacsgQgybh4u6DnLEveH
transaction
2fb785ab3e7755d512005dd6ec9aaaf3bcc3e9160beb8fe741d304973e252cf9
spent
true